Analog or digital?
The next question is whether to opt for a traditional spring balance based analog food scale or whether to go for those sleek-looking stylish digital food scales. The look factor is clear - the traditional scales simply don't stand a chance. The bright backlights with electronic displays make the digital food scales way more attractive than the conventional ones. And there are other factors too that would make you want to prefer having a digital kitchen scale for processing your food requirements over its analog counterpart.

Going digital with your food scale will give you an excellent precision in your process of measurement. You will be able to measure the exact quantities of food that you want. In fact, the best quality food scales are also referred to as gram scales because of the precision in their weight measuring capabilities. This high level of precision is derived by using electronic measurement of the weight.

Why choose a gram scale?
Digital food scales are also often called gram scales. Gram scales are the best ones when it comes to precision. These scales let you have the most accurate reading possible because of two reasons. One reason is that the measurement system is digital rather than analog, making the measurement accurate to the level of a gram. And the other reason is that it is not just the measurement but also the rendering of the measurement that is accurate. This is because the display is digital and it shows you the exact number of grams read, leaving nothing to the approximation of the reader.
